try also to to camo yourself a bit too

with ya d68 you ain't got the range so you really wanna be as stealthy as possible

Iv'e seen peeps arrive with quite bold colours or track suit with vivid stripes down the sides

I'm hardly one to talk - jeans & boots but I got a bit or range and deffo I avoid following

other "camo'd" & better players than me and perhaps giving away their position so easily

Deffo tape ya gun up a little if possible - it is so easily noticed that slight glance of orange through the bushes

and keep your own colours dark-ish to help blend in a bit too

use cover - sprint - don't jog to cover, pop ya head out but keep the rest of you in

peek high - peek low, blah blah blah, practice peeking left/shooting left handed

take more than one battery and/or another gun with battery just in case

don't get stressed if you don't get loads of kills your first time - go with the idea to see what its all about

that way you will still have a chance of having fun - which is the most important thing imho

All I will say is that I have been defending our base with some of the more experienced players.....

And was amazed just how quickly they spotted some of the enemy advancing.........

30yrds - 11 o'clock - got him

25yrds - 2 o'clock - got him

blimey I said you got good eyes/scope - nah I just love them 2-toner's he replied

Now I am as blind as a bat so it may my noobish inexperienced eyes may not spot you straight away

but other more experienced players are more trained to spot the slightest blip on their vision radar

I've seen it numerous times first hand how they detect the slightest thing out of place - focus & fire

Some colours are better than others - green or blue say is not quite as bad as day-glo orange

But moment the green/brown view has a splash of any other colour in it - especially high vis orange

your eyes pick it up and you give it it your full attention is all I will say

Your G&G shows very little red as grip/stock is disguised/covered by yourself if ADS - just a bit of ris showing

OP's D68 is a LOT more vivid orange on display

Many on here paint their RIF's with a camo brown/tan/dark green etc...

Not only to customise it and put their own mark on it - well yeah a lot of airsoft is for show & stuff

but there is also a bit of practical in this too

best ones I have seen is where their own gun almost prefectly matches on their cammo/loadout

(not just a black gun & black hoodie but really put in the time & effort to achieve max stealth - and look damn good too)

All the above applies to woodland - general cqb cammo means very little
